Just wondering if you played these in game yet. Cause I did something similar in SFC2. However the game reads the model as being as high and long as it is wide. In other words my ship would collide with the planet long before I ever got near it. The game also read the space between the planets as part of the planet. Did you find a work around for this? Thats why a long time ago I asked if planet collisions could be turned off somehow. I did find away to add planets by using the scenery mods. Which is the route I plan on using for the SFC3 mod as it will not add any polies to the game.

As far as the collition is concerned, yes I've tried some models in-game and they work fine. The moons seemed to work as a separate part and you can collide against them and you can get close to the planet without exploding. The same happens with the rings, in fact I've moved the rings under the plane in wich the ship flies "and you can actually fly above the rings...!!!"
I will post some in-game screenshots as soon as I can. (I am at work now)
What I haven't tried yet is to locate the moons very far from the planet to see if I can fly between them. But I guess it will work just fine.

Also I have transferred a chunk of SFC3 planets (not all of them) to SFC:OP along with the SPACE MOD (and a few James Formo additions) I've been VERY happy with the results.

Initially, I had some problems with SFC3 planet SIZE being such that they would blow up one or more space stations parked in orbit in one of Nuclear Wessels BASE DEFENSE mission. I fixed that by replacing the planet model with a stock OP sized planet, LOL.

I'm having problems when I locate the moons or the rings very far from the planet:
Unfortunately, you cannot fly between the objects and  the atmosphere efect looks really, really bad.
I think the best way would be making the moons small and next to the planet. And I'm thinking about making the rins as an asteroid ring because I don't like the way it looks.
